Fifty years ago, on September 9, 1963, NBC’s evening news broadcast expanded from 15 minutes to half an hour. Anchors David Brinkley and Chet Huntley interviewed President John F. Kennedy in the Oval Office. The interview covered a wide range of topics including Vietnam. When it was over, there was small talk — about the expanding broadcast and the movie “Charade.”Sept. 9, 2013
